Best Schools for Heavy Equipment Maintenance Technology/Technician in the Great Lakes Region
Below are the schools that deliver the strongest overall heavy equipment maintenance technology/technician education in the Great Lakes Region.
Top Schools in Heavy Equipment Maintenance Technology/Technician
Northeast Wisconsin Technical College is one of the finest schools in the country for getting a degree in heavy equipment maintenance technology/technician. Set in the city of Green Bay, Northeast Wisconsin Technical College is a large public institution. About 44 heavy equipment maintenance technology/technician degrees were awarded at Northeast Wisconsin Technical College in the most recent year. Heavy Equipment Maintenance Technology/technician graduates of Northeast Wisconsin Technical College earn a median of $42,016 early in their careers. Typical student debt for the program is $14,997.

Madison Area Technical College came in at #2 on our 2026 list of the best heavy equipment maintenance technology/technician schools. Set in the city of Madison, Madison Area Technical College is a large public institution. There were roughly 10 heavy equipment maintenance technology/technician students who graduated with this degree at Madison Area Technical College in the most recent data year. Heavy Equipment Maintenance Technology/technician graduates of Madison Area Technical College earn a median of $44,279 early in their careers. Madison Area Technical College graduates carry a median of $16,812 in student loans.

Rend Lake College is a great choice for students pursuing a degree in heavy equipment maintenance technology/technician, landing the #3 spot this year. Located in the rural area of Ina, Rend Lake College is a mid-sized public university. There were roughly 30 heavy equipment maintenance technology/technician students who graduated with this degree at Rend Lake College in the most recent data year. Students who receive their heavy equipment maintenance technology/technician degree from Rend Lake College earn around $61,677 in the first couple years of their career. Rend Lake College graduates carry a median of $8,688 in student loans.

Students looking for a strong heavy equipment maintenance technology/technician program will find one at Western Technical College La Cross, which ranked #4. Western Technical College La Cross is a moderately-sized public school located in the city of La Crosse. Western Technical College La Cross awarded about 21 heavy equipment maintenance technology/technician degrees in the most recent data year. Students who receive their heavy equipment maintenance technology/technician degree from Western Technical College La Cross earn around $46,591 in the first couple years of their career. Typical student debt for the program is $9,166.

Ferris State University came in at #5 on our 2026 list of the best heavy equipment maintenance technology/technician schools. This large public university is located in the town of Big Rapids. About 56% of students finish within six years. There were roughly 25 heavy equipment maintenance technology/technician students who graduated with this degree at Ferris State University in the most recent data year. Students who receive their heavy equipment maintenance technology/technician degree from Ferris State University earn around $60,432 in the first couple years of their career. Students borrow a median of $18,125 to complete this degree.

Chippewa Valley Technical College placed #6 among the best heavy equipment maintenance technology/technician schools. Located in the city of Eau Claire, Chippewa Valley Technical College is a large public university. About 15 heavy equipment maintenance technology/technician degrees were awarded at Chippewa Valley Technical College in the most recent year. Graduates of the heavy equipment maintenance technology/technician program make about $56,053 in their early career. Students borrow a median of $12,000 to complete this degree.

Notes and References
This ranking is produced by College Factual (MF_RANKING_2025), 2026 edition. Schools are scored on a blend of student outcomes (graduation rate, post-graduation earnings), affordability, and program focus, drawn primarily from the U.S. Department of Education (IPEDS and College Scorecard).
Ranking method: College Major Top Ranked · 15 schools evaluated.
- The Integrated Postsecondary Education Data System (IPEDS) from the National Center for Education Statistics (NCES), a branch of the U.S. Department of Education (DOE), serves as the core of our data about colleges.
- Some other college data, including much of the graduate earnings data, comes from the U.S. Department of Education’s (College Scorecard).
